Toon Boom and The SPA Studios Sign Technology Collaboration Agreement to Push the Limits of Animation, Design and Concept Art


MONTREAL, Nov. 19, 2015 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Toon Boom Animation announced today a technology collaboration agreement with The SPA Studios for their hybrid animated feature film currently in development and slated for theatrical release in 2019. Klaus is the latest animated feature film project by Sergio Pablos, co-creator of Despicable Me. Klaus is an animated comedy set at Christmas time and will be a heartfelt family movie for all ages.

Toon Boom will work with The SPA Studios to integrate their flagship product Toon Boom Harmony™. Harmony will give the production the visually beautiful imagery required for Klaus. Toon Boom will work with The SPA Studios to push their pipeline to new heights by building innovative tools that will enable them to execute their story vision until final production. Harmony will be the primary animation software used for the production and The SPA Studios’ creative and technical teams will work closely with Toon Boom to create the highest quality of animation design and style.

“The trailer for Klaus is already seen as a game changer for the animation industry,” states Francisco Del Cueto, CTO at Toon Boom Animation. “We are very excited to be working with The SPA Studios to build a new generation of animation tools that will help define a new benchmark for animation quality and style.”

Klaus includes many innovative techniques including complex, interactive lighting and the use of advanced texturing capabilities.

“The studio is using a hybrid technique to create visuals; we do not see this project as simply another 2D animated film. Our goal was to find solutions to overcome the technical limitations which prevented us from achieving a traditional and classic animated style,” said Pablos, Director of The SPA Studios. “We’re just getting started, but the possibilities are very exciting. And, if your intention is to put something that feels hand-crafted on the screen, there’s no shorter path than starting from a hand-crafted medium.”

About The SPA Studios

Sergio Pablos founded The SPA Studios in Madrid, Spain. The studio focuses on offering the highest quality animation for clients, such as Universal, Blue Sky, Warner and Disney. They also develop original stories for feature animation movies, such as the box office hit Despicable Me. Klaus will be the first animated feature to be directed and produced by Pablos.

About Sergio Pablos

Sergio Pablos’s career includes credits as Supervising Animator for the following Disney titles: Tarzan, Hunchback of Notre Dame, Hercules, and Treasure Planet, just to name a few. Pablos’s work has led him to be nominated twice for the Annie Awards—for his character design work on Rio (Fox Pictures) and for character animation on Treasure Planet (Disney).
